What I respect about Iwata is that not only was he a CEO, but he was an executive who actually was ALSO a game developer, and a pretty great one at that. (Just look at the stories surrounding Pokemon Gold and Silver or Earthbound, for example. He loved to save projects that were in limbo.) He was also at heart a gamer. He understood more of what it was like to have fun with playing games and wanted everyone to be able to enjoy it. He understood how they were made. He also understood business. That's why his quote is amazing. "On my business card, I am a corporate president. In my mind, I am a game developer. But in my heart, I am a gamer." In order to best understand how the industry was going, it was necessary for him to be all three.

@Ramona122003
@Ramona122003 4 месяца назад
It was more a change with the times. Having more powerful consoles did impacted gameplay since a game like Super Mario World wouldn't have been possible on the NES. Just as Mario 64 couldn't be done on the SNES. However, starting with the GameCube, fewer games wouldn't have been possible without the increase in power. Pikmin 1 being one of the few examples of a game that couldn't be done on the N64. After that, outside of the graphics, you would have a harder time naming games that wouldn't have been possible on old-generation machines.
@DocTime56
@DocTime56 4 месяца назад
@@Ramona122003adding to your comments, more power means devs have to get less creative to circumvent hardware limitations. Take for example Animal Forest on the N64, the reason the world curves was a measure to avoid popping, but it became a very distinctive part of Animal Crossing’s visual style. Or another example would be silent hill, the fog was just hiding how low the render distance was, but then they doubled down on it on Silent Hill 2 and became iconic to the series.
@Ramona122003
@Ramona122003 4 месяца назад
@@DocTime56 Graphic limitations play a big part in gaming. Mario's entire look happened because of the limits of technology at the time. Or how the doors in Metroid Prime were reworked from the 2D Metroid games to hid the load screens to make what appeared to be seamless world. Even during the Switch-era this is still in play. The Blood Moon in Breath of the Wild and Tears of the Kingdom was design to refresh the world on top of respawning enemies. Which is why a 'panic' Blood Moon happens when the game is about to crash.

I mean... all he did was take the trends he was noticing to their logical conclusion. The N64 received so few games because games were taking longer to develop at the quality that Nintendo wanted, especially without third party developers to fall back on. We saw the same trend with the incoming 7th generation consoles, where to compensate for game development times of increasing length, publishers quickly remastered older games in HD. Back in the days of the NES, games could theoretically be made in a few months or, in some cases, weeks. Iwata understood that. He understood that there was a middle ground that had to be met to maintain trust with the consumer. At the time, his understanding may have been a bit too safe compared to today, but the core idea stood and still stands today. What Iwata believed was less of him being a "prophet" and more of him taking things to their logical conclusion, while also playing things safe for the time. Him being on the nose today is the result of the trends he noticed not slowing down over time.
